Transaction 86e25405db1684ae67788747520fdde13dc5844fc3476860497f7a0240981fa7
1 Input
2 Outputs
- 86e25405db1684ae67788747520fdde13dc5844fc3476860497f7a0240981fa7:0
- 86e25405db1684ae67788747520fdde13dc5844fc3476860497f7a0240981fa7:1
value 99977500
address mzMTcH6kzT2NP6kEX8RUDq6UrzPX5xhtrg
value 10000000
address 2N8hwP1WmJrFF5QWABn38y63uYLhnJYJYTF